Depreciation is a very common form to immunize oneself against learning a foreign language. The own language becomes a very cultivated, well developed and distinct status, whereas all other tongues are comparatively primitive. It is therefore the model for evaluating the level of other languages.
„Hungarian is so primitive, because of its regular forms“, is often heard in this context. From another point of view you can say that German is very primitive, because of its irregular and synthetic forms, which are a relict of a linguistic status of the Neolithicum (and English – with its analytical grammar – has reached a modern and developed status).
„Barbaroi“, foreign people were called by the Greek. They thought, that only they had a wellformed articulation and all others speek thickly. This is expressed by this designation, which originally means „blabbers“.
